## Deploying the Gatewick Proctor Queue

Deploys are pretty painless: push to main, wait for the pipeline, then watch the queue drain dashboard for five minutes. If candidates pile up mid-exam, roll back first and ask questions later — the queue replays safely. Everything the workers care about lives in one config block, shown here for reference.

settings of bafof-yagef:
JOROX_PIN=8740
JOROX_TENANT=pelox
JOROX_METRICS_HOST=metrics.jorox.qorvelworks.internal
JOROX_SEAL=seal_c78f63c1
JOROX_STANDBY_TEAM=norax

Status: warranty claims on the Vexler 300 line are 38% over plan for the half-year. Root cause: seal degradation in units built at the Corvane plant before the tooling change. Remediation underway; supplier cost-sharing under negotiation with Dremholt Components. Reserve topped up last month — expect a visible hit in the quarterly figures. Do not discuss externally until the supplier agreement lands. Customer comms handled by field service only. How this feeds the forward plan is noted below.

management briefing: Project Ulavan slips by two quarters because of the staffing delay.

Action item: The Relayn deploy-status bot silently dropped updates when the pipeline API paginated results, so responders believed a rollback had completed when it had not. We will add pagination handling, a staleness banner, and an integration test. Until merged, verify deploy state directly in the pipeline console, documented at the page below.

runbook for kahop-kajop: https://rundeck.ordinio.test/display/secrets/pipeline/issue/pages/repo/browse/e5732776e07d1285107e5aeb